Output c3fa4c4fe790874354c2aec7519735a1848d512e6f1b160a6838c286c07ff51d:0

value
151320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d66051e0f91c7a371da0a2deb96a86f5bc1011 OP_EQUAL
address
3H5kFtpLk9icp1AWD9ahcTeJo7tKUq1tTn
transaction
c3fa4c4fe790874354c2aec7519735a1848d512e6f1b160a6838c286c07ff51d
spent
true